Skip to content

Commit 64e942e

Browse files
committed
chore: add Floating UI core script registration
1 parent dfd793b commit 64e942e

File tree

1 file changed

+16
-6
lines changed

1 file changed

+16
-6
lines changed

blablablocks-formats.php

Lines changed: 16 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-37,24 +37,33 @@ function blablablocks_register_assets()
3737
true
3838
);
3939

40-
// Register infotip format web component script
40+
// Register Floating UI script
4141
wp_register_script(
42-
'blablablocks-infotip-format-asset',
43-
plugins_url('assets/web-components/infotip.js', __FILE__),
44-
['blablablocks-floating-ui-dom-asset'],
45-
$version,
42+
'blablablocks-floating-ui-asset',
43+
'https://cdn.jsdelivr.net/npm/@floating-ui/core@1.7.0',
44+
[],
45+
'1.7.0',
4646
true
4747
);
4848

4949
// Register Floating UI DOM script
5050
wp_register_script(
5151
'blablablocks-floating-ui-dom-asset',
5252
'https://cdn.jsdelivr.net/npm/@floating-ui/dom@1.7.0',
53-
[],
53+
['blablablocks-floating-ui-asset'],
5454
'1.7.0',
5555
true
5656
);
5757

58+
// Register infotip format web component script
59+
wp_register_script(
60+
'blablablocks-infotip-format-asset',
61+
plugins_url('assets/web-components/infotip.js', __FILE__),
62+
['blablablocks-floating-ui-dom-asset'],
63+
$version,
64+
true
65+
);
66+
5867
// Register main formats script.
5968
wp_register_script(
6069
'blablablocks-formats',
@@ -64,6 +73,7 @@ function blablablocks_register_assets()
6473
[
6574
'blablablocks-marker-format-asset',
6675
'blablablocks-infotip-format-asset',
76+
'blablablocks-floating-ui-asset',
6777
'blablablocks-floating-ui-dom-asset',
6878
]
6979
),

0 commit comments

Comments
 (0)